Spend your summer immersed in a fusion of high quality training and professional performances in this life-changing opportunity.

You can participate in a unique 7 week musical theater experience that includes 2 weeks of training and rehearsals, 2 weeks of a professional technical rehearsal process that culminates into 3 weeks of professional performances of Disney’s The Little Mermaid at the Tony Award-Winning theater in the heart of the Dallas Arts District, Dallas Theater Center.

Spend your days at the Wyly Theater in daily training taught by professional Teaching Artists. You will have the opportunity to explore vocal techniques, build confidence as a dancer, and hone your acting skills while making friends, learning from professional actors, and being in a professional production as we all bring the story of Disney’s The Little Mermaid to life.

How to Enroll

Submit Application by May 1:
Applications are now open.

Auditions in the month of May:
All students will be required to audition as part of their application process for SummerStage 2024. Students who complete the application will be allotted a spot in the program; however, the auditions will allow us to know the students better and be able to create a program that will be both enjoyable and rigorous.

Tuition paid in full by June 1 :
Tuition must be paid in full by June 1 through the link that will be provided upon receipt of application.

Sample Schedule: Training and Rehearsal

9:00 – 10:00 AM: Acting Training
10:00 AM 11:00 AM: Vocal Training
11:00 AM – 12:00 PM: Dance Training
12:00 PM – 1:00 PM: Lunch
1:00 PM to 4:00PM: Little Mermaid Rehearsals

*Early Drop Off [as early as 8:00 AM] is available for $50 per student
*Late Pick Up [as late as 5:00 PM] is available for $50 per student

Requirements

This program is created for students between the ages of 8 – 16 years old, who are interested in performing arts, specifically musical theater. Experience is welcomed but not required.
